Full Description
13 MAY 2026 UPDATE
Vendor shall demonstrate its ability to adhere to the treatment and finish requirements outlined in the technical drawings.
END UPDATE
12 MAY 2026 UPDATE
Please ensure responses to this Sources Sought Notice demonstrate the following:
1. The vendor's ability to build the Clam Shell Door.
2. What (if any) portion of the work is expected to be subcontracted.
3. The vendor must have a current certification for SAE AS9100D (or subsequent revisions) – Quality Management Systems – Requirements for Aviation, Space, and Defense Organizations
4. The vendor must possess at least one of the following FAA qualifications: FAA-certified Repair Station designation under 14 CFR Part 145, or in-house FAA Designated Engineering Representatives (DERs) authorized under Parts 23, 25, CAR 3, and CAR 4b
END UPDATE
This is NOT a solicitation. The Air Force Life Cycle Management Center, Cryptologic and Cyber Systems Division Contracting Branch, (AFLCMC/HNCK), Joint Base San Antonio Lackland intends to award, a Fixed Price Purchase Order for the following build-to-order part:
Item Description: Clam Shell Door Assembly
P/N: R68730 Qty: 20
The Government intends to solicit as a 100% small business set-aside.
The proposed contract action is for the purchase of build-to-order Clamshell Door Assembly. The clamshell door is installed on the U-1C Foils, which are installed on the government aircraft system. The front of the foil features a clamshell door that must open and close reliably in a harsh flight environment where windspeeds can exceed 500 mph, exposing filter papers to the incoming airstream.
Detailed technical data and drawings are available from the government upon request.
If a Vendor believes it can meet the Government’s requirement, it may identify its interest and capability to the Contract Officer, Ms. Thayer Riley, thayer.riley@us.af.mil and Contract Specialist, LaToya Perry-Jenkins, Latoya.perry-jenkins.ctr@us.af.mil.
Any interested source are invited to submit a written qualification package for review and approval for the purchase of these items.
If there are any questions regarding this notice shall be submitted by 3 p.m. CDT on 11 May 2026.
Respones to all questions will be provided to all interested vendors by noon CDT 15 May 2026.
The written qualification package must include the following information:
1) Contractor name, POC, phone number, NAICS, and Cage Code
2) A brief statement detailing capabilities and whether they can meet the Governments’ quantity amount with estimated cost per unit and total. The written statement should be limited to two (2) pages.
3) Type of business, and whether they are large, small, any socio-economic classification, and whether they are U.S. or foreign owned.
